Living Room Wall Interior Design





Setting the mood and ambiance of a living room is mostly dependent on how the walls are designed. The following are some suggestions for living room wall décor:


Accent Wall: Use wallpaper with a striking design or paint a single wall a vibrant color to create a focal point. This gives the area more depth and visual appeal without taking up too much room.


Gallery Wall: Incorporate individuality and elegance into the living area by showcasing a carefully chosen assortment of pictures, framed prints, and artwork. To give the impression of a gallery, arrange the items in a logical arrangement, either symmetrically or asymmetrically.





Play with Texture: Use texture to give the walls more depth and appeal to the touch. To add warmth and visual appeal, think about using materials like wood paneling, stone veneer, exposed brick, or textured wallpaper.


Install wall molding or paneling to give your living room more architectural character and class. Select from a variety of styles, such as wainscoting, beadboard, or shiplap, to go well with the overall design.





Mirrors: To visually enlarge the area and improve natural light, use mirrors. To provide depth and openness, hang a huge mirror above the couch or hearth. A gallery of smaller mirrors may also be made for a show that serves both aesthetic and practical purposes.


Floating Shelves: To showcase books, ornamental items, and sentimental items, install floating shelves on the walls. This acts as a design feature that is readily customizable and updated, in addition to adding storage and organizing.




Wall Decals and Murals: Removable wall decals or murals give the living space individuality and whimsical touches. For a whimsical and artistic touch, pick designs that appeal to you or go well with the room's general concept.


Vertical Gardens: Construct a vertical garden or living wall to bring the outside inside. To bring color, texture, and freshness into the room, install wall-mounted planters or shelving units and stock them with a variety of indoor plants.




Integrated Media Wall: Construct a media wall that skillfully combines components for storage, audio, and TV. For a sleek and uncluttered appearance, hide cables and cords behind the wall. You may also add built-in cabinets or shelves to arrange media accessories.


Lighting Effects: To draw attention to architectural details or wall artwork, use lighting effects like LED strips, wall sconces, or recessed lighting. The living area may have a variety of moods and ambiances thanks to adjustable lighting.



To get a unified and harmonious effect, take into account the living room's general style, color scheme, and layout while creating the walls. Try out various concepts and components to make a unique and welcoming space that expresses your preferences and way of life.
